Method notes 3 notes
  • Static load; ignores fatigue, set and stress relaxation.
  • The coils stay closed until the load exceeds the initial tension Fᵢ; below that the spring does not extend.
  • Hook/loop ends are the highest-stressed region and are not stress-checked here.
